    Profil

    1995 – 1999    Biomedical Engineering, University of Applied Sciences Giessen-Friedberg, Germany

    1998 – 1999    Maîtrisse Ingénierie de la Santé (Bachelor Degree), Radiobiology, Radiotoxicity, Radiation
                               protection (German - French double diploma) Institut Universitaire Professionnel,
                               Montpellier, France

    1999 – 2000    Engineer Research, Research group on movement disorders in children (neurosurgical
                               department, University Hospital Montpellier
    )

    2000 – 2001    Radiation and Medical Imaging Master’s Degree, University Paul-Sabatier, Toulouse, France

    2001 – 2005    PhD in Neurosciences, Department of Medicine, University of Montpellier

    2007 – 2008    R&D Engineer, Company Intrasense, Montpellier, France

    2008 – 2016    Research Associate, University of Applied Sciences and Arts Northwestern Switzerland,
                               Muttenz, Switzerland

    2013                  Habilitation, Technical Faculty, Linköping University, Linköping, Sweden

    Since 2010      Guest researcher, Technical Faculty, Linköping University, Linköping, Sweden

    Since 2016      Professor in Neural Engineering, University of Applied Sciences and Arts Northwestern
                              Switzerland, Muttenz, Switzerland
